Police leaders call on Burnham to prevent early release of PC Andrew Harper’s killers

Police federation chair emotional over potential release of PC Andrew Harper’s killers
  • Fifty policing leaders across the UK have signed an open letter calling on Prime Minister Andy Burnham to prevent the early release of PC Andrew Harper‘s killers.
  • Jessie Cole and Albert Bowers were sentenced to 13 years for manslaughter in 2020 but could be eligible for release by January under plans to ease prison overcrowding.
  • Police chiefs have suggested amending the Sentencing Act to exempt individuals convicted of killing emergency service workers in the line of duty from early release.
  • PC Harper’s mother, Debbie Adlam, criticised the potential early releases as a rush job and called for better protection for all emergency service workers.
  • Justice Secretary Alex Norris stated the government is considering all serious options to address prison capacity while keeping dangerous offenders behind bars.
